Dagger

The Metropolitan Museum of Art

The dagger has a long, curved blade made of silver metal with visible scratches. The blade's surface appears worn. The blade's width tapers from a wide base near the handle to a sharp point at the tip. A gold-colored metal band encircles the base of the blade, adjacent to the handle. The handle is made of dark brown wood, featuring a distinctive shape with a narrower middle section and wider top and bottom sections.
